Ukraine: Two Russians Undergo Trial In Kiev

Two men accused of waging war against Ukrainian troops have gone on trial in Kiev accused of waging war against Ukrainian troops.

The pair described as Russian special-forces, named as Yevgeny Yerofeyev and Alexander Alexandrov and alleged to be officers in Russia's GRU foreign military intelligence, was captured in May during fighting in east Ukraine.

Prosecutors called for life sentences and the hearing was adjourned despite Russia’s insistence that the men were not serving soldiers when they were detained.

The two men deny charges of terrorism.

Tuesday's hearing coincided with the resumption of a trial in southern Russia, where Ukrainian air-force pilot Nadia Savchenko is accused of involvement in the deaths of two Russian journalists.

She insists she was captured by rebels before the journalists were killed in a mortar attack and then smuggled over the border into Russia illegally. Russian officials suggest she crossed the border herself, posing as a refugee.

Ms Savchenko, who has become a Ukrainian MP during her detention in Russia, dismissed the case against her as a “piece of rubbish”  when the trial began last week.
